What light isn't working? The Ipack is mostly software driven, so the wiring going to it is power and data cables.

From memory, the engine light warning comes from the ECM via the CAN line. I think the oil light is a simple low / high signal from the oil pressure switch, but I'd need to look at the wiring diagram to confirm.
The outside temperature signal comes from the CJB as a data on the medium speed bus.
However this could be dependent on year of the the vehicle.

I've had a dig through the wiring diagram, and as suspected, everything light and gauge wise is supplied by a data line on the medium speed data bus. The ECM sends data through the CJB to be forwarded on to the Ipack, or wherever else the data needs to go. I'd start by checking the electric connections on the CJB and ECM, and all the fuses in the engine bay fuse box.

When I get in my F2, I put the key/fob in the reseptical, foot on brake, press the start button and it fires up. I'm not sure if it does a self test on the bulbs.

I just did a test. I put the fob in and pressed the start button. This puts the car into the olde worlde 'Acc' key position where the radio comes on. I then did a long hold of the button and this puts it into olde worlde 'Ignition On' position. When this happens all the LEDs light up on a self test.
